看了官方的文档,始终不得要领,多次反复摸索以后,最终还是成功了,特此发帖留作纪念,也请官方的人员指正一下是否有误。
1.解压uni-zpp.zip到uni-app文件夹(历史版本统统覆盖到这个目录)
2.下载安装HbuilderX(已有则跳过),并打开Hbuilder软件一次,要不插件不会自动安装。
3.注册HbuilderX个人开发者账号(已有则跳过)
4.在HbuilderX插件市场搜索sass插件,下载并自动安装(已有则跳过)
5.安装微信开发者工具(已有则跳过),扫码登录。
6.开启微信开发者工具的服务:微信开发者工具->设置->安全->服务端口:开启,默认信任项目:开启
7.HbuilderX里设置微信开发者工具的路径:工具菜单->运行配置->微信开发者工具运行路径,浏览...
8.HbuilderX里打开/config/app.js,设置httpApi和wsApi的值为生产网站的域名
9.HbuilderX里打开/pages.json,删除直播插件引用的节点,参考 这篇文章
10.HbuilderX里打开/manifest.json,基础配置,设置uniApp应用标识,要去HbuilderX的个人中心自己注册一个新的应用,才会有这个值
10.HbuilderX里打开/manifest.json,微信小程序配置,输入正确的小程序appID
11.测试小程序:点击HbuilderX菜单:运行->运行到小程序模拟器->微信小程序模拟器->微信开发者工具->会自动唤起微信开发者工具预览效果
12.提交小程序包到微信小程序审核后台:点击HbuilderX菜单:发(fa)行->小程序-微信->发行,将自动编译打包,唤起微信开发者工具,确定没问题后,点击开发者工具的[上传]按钮,输入发版信息点提交。
特别注意:
1.从HbuilderX的[运行]菜单里唤起开发者工具后,不要点上传,通不过代码包大小检测的,我就犯了这个错误,总提示分包大小不通过,浪费了好多时间,其实并不是分包大小的问题,要从[发行]菜单里面点进开发者工具,打包,这个时候的分包大小才对的。发行菜单应该叫做【发布】或者发版才对。这一点官方文档里也没有明确说明。
2.设置uniApp应用标识我发现不能直接在HbuilderX界面上改,实际上我已经申请过这个id了,我就只好用其他文本编辑器编辑好了这个值再保存的。
{{item.user_info.nickname ? item.user_info.nickname : item.user_name}}
作者 管理员 企业
{{itemf.name}}
{{itemc.user_info.nickname}}
{{itemc.user_name}}
回复 {{itemc.comment_user_info.nickname}}
{{itemf.name}}